HC Deb 05 December 1975 vol 901 cc384-5W
Mr. Hooley

asked the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s how many political prisoners are currently held by the Smith régime in Zimbabwe under sentence of death.

Mr. Ennals

We have seen Press reports which suggest that 13 persons are currently under sentence of death in Rhodesia for alleged terrorist offences. As the illegal régime have announced thatonce death sentence has been passed and an appeal failed it should be assumed that the execution has taken place", some of these men may already have been executed.

Mr. Hooley

asked the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s how many political prisoners have been executed by the Smith régime in Zimbabwe during the past five years.

Mr. Ennals

Comprehensive information about the crimes for which individuals have been hanged by the illegal régime is not available. According to Press reports, 52 prisoners have been executed in the last five years, but this figure includes common law criminals as well as alleged terrorists.

Mr. Hooley

asked the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s how many executions by hanging have been carried out by the illegal Smith régime in Zimbabwe since November 1965.

Mr. Ennals

As far as we are aware, 60 people were executed in Rhodesia between November 1965 and April 1975. Since 21st April 1975 the illegal régime have published no announcements of executions. It is not possible, therefore, to say with certainty whether any executions have been carried out since then.

Mr. Hooley

asked the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s if he will advise Her Majesty to reprieve all persons currently under sentence of death in Zimbabwe.

Mr. Ennals

I do not consider that this would achieve the desired result. The illegal régime ignored the exercise of the Royal Prerogative of Mercy in 1968, even though they then still claimed to recognise the Queen as Sovereign.
